Eating Too Much Sugar Causes Diabetes - Fact Or Fiction?

Like most diseases, there is plenty of fact and fiction and often the two become intertwined and diabetes is no exception. Most people think that eating too much sugar cause diabetes, this is not true.

Diabetes is not caused by eating sugar. Diabetes is caused by a combination of genetic and environmental factors. However, eating a diet high in fat and sugar can cause you to become overweight.

Yo can catch diabetes from someone else - Fact or fiction?

This brings me nicely to another common myth about diabetes, that it can be passed from person to person by everyday contact (SOURCE: Diabetes UK). Although we don't know exactly why some people get diabetes, we know that it is not contagious - it can't be caught like a cold or flu. There seems to be some genetic link involved particularly Type 2 diabetes. But environmental factors also play a part.

That's enough Diabetes Fiction now for some fact

Diabetes is a metabolic disorder characterised by abnormally high blood sugar levels due either to lower production of insulin or abnormal resistance to insulin's effects.

The major symptoms are excessive thirst, frequent urination, muscle cramps, poor healing of wounds, impaired vision and itching.

Heart disease and stroke - caused by diseased coronary arteries supplying blood to brain- are also common complications associated with diabetes.

As people age, insulin production may diminish and/or insulin resistance may increase. If the consumption of food, especially food that causes rapid surges in blood sugar levels, remains high, blood sugar levels may become and remain abnormally high, which is the condition known as diabetes.

The serious consequences of this are collapse, a diabetic fit followed by diabetic coma and if not treated quickly, death can occur.

Cayenne Pepper And Water Diet - Fad or Fiction?

Have you heard of the cayenne pepper and water diet? Controversy has recently surrounded the so-called cayenne pepper and water diet, primarily due to it's association with Beyonce Knowles who apparently lost 20 pounds during filming for the movie "Dreamgirls" living only on cayenne pepper and water. The facts are not in dispute, the actress did apparently lose weight quickly over a short period and there is no reason to dispute how this was achieved.

However the question that must be asked is can this be called a "diet"? Some would say that what Beyonce Knowles did was simply starve herself of food, surviving solely on liquids. Surely the cayenne pepper had no noticeable effects other than perhaps adding a little taste to the water?

It should perhaps be noted that there are certainly recorded health benefits associated with cayenne pepper, including aiding digestion, strengthening of the heart, claims it contains mild pain relieving qualities, and there are even reports of using cayenne as a dressing for wounds.

Even taking these reported benefits into account, can this cayenne pepper and water diet really be called a diet? It should more properly be seen as a purely starvation exercise undertaken by a committed actor wishing to lose weight quickly in pursuit of her art and career, presumably with the safety net afforded to highly paid and closely monitored movie stars. Presumably she will have been surrounded by assistants and helpers who would have been immediately on hand had Beyonce suffered from any starvation effects or ill health.

The danger in this story as with other fad diets is that impressionable people, young girls in particular, will have heard about this seemingly miraculous cayenne pepper and water diet and will wish to try it themselves, without any regard to the obvious and significant health dangers inherent in starving yourself in such a way. In particular this form of dieting could be very damaging if sustained for any length of time, any form of fasting should be carefully monitored for signs of deteriorating health.

It should also be said that this story and the controversy it has created are not the fault of Beyonce Knowles, rather it is created by media hype attempting to profit from the possibility others may try and follow her example. In recent times other actors have been required to lose weight quickly for their future roles, for example Christian Bale in the movie The Machinist. The actor dropped his weight to a dangerously low level by reportedly eating a single apple and a tin of tuna every day, but this did not become the "apple and tuna" fad diet, probably because Christian Bale does not have the same widespread fashionable image as Beyonce.

So in conclusion is this really a Diet? I would suggest not, with the hype surrounding it currently it could be categorized as a fad, and potentially a dangerous one. The only safe way to permanently lose weight is to eat healthy food, eat in moderation, and crucially undertake regular exercise. If you do this you will burn excess fat, your arteries will stay clear and healthy and you won't risk damaging your body by starving it of the food it needs to stay fit and healthy.

The Effect of Deforestation

Deforestation is the process of converting forested lands into non-forest sites that are ideal for crop raising, urbanization and industrialization. Because deforestation is a serious concept, there are also serious effects to the surroundings.

Effects of deforestation can be classified and grouped into effects to biodiversity, environment and social settings. Because deforestation basically involves killing trees in forests, there are so many effects that can be enumerated as results of the activity.

Environment change

One major effect of deforestation is climate change. Changes to the surroundings done by deforestation work in many ways. One, there is abrupt change in temperatures in the nearby areas. Forests naturally cool down because they help retain moisture in the air.

Second is the long process of global climate change. As mentioned above, deforestation has been found to contribute to global warming or that process when climates around the world become warmer as more harmful rays of the sun comes in through the atmosphere.

The ozone layer is a mass of oxygen or O3 atoms that serves as shield in the atmosphere against the harmful ultraviolet rays from the sun. Because ozone is made up of oxygen atoms, oxygen react with carbon monoxide. Such reaction would use up oxygen atoms.

It follows that when there are more carbon monoxide atoms going to the atmosphere, the volume of oxygen would decline. Such is the case of ozone depletion.

The third effect to the environment would be on the water table underneath the ground. Water table is the common source of natural drinking water by people living around forests.

Water table is replenishing. That means, the supply of water underground could also dry up if not replenished regularly. When there is rain, forests hold much of the rainfall to the soil through their roots.

Thus, water sinks in deeper to the ground, and eventually replenishing the supply of water in the water table. Now, imagine what happens when there is not enough forests anymore. Water from rain would simply flow through the soil surface and not be retained by the soil.

Or other than that, the water from rain would not stay in the soil longer, for the process of evaporation would immediately set in. Thus, the water table is not replenished, leading to drying up of wells.

Effect to biodiversity

Forests are natural habitats to many types of animals and organisms. That is why, when there is deforestation, many animals are left without shelters. Those that manage to go through the flat lands and residential sites are then killed by people.

Through the years, it is estimated that there are millions of plant and extinct animal species that have been wiped out because they have been deprived of home. Thus, biodiversity is significantly lowered because of the savage deforestation practices of some people.

Wildlife advocates have been constantly reminding that several wild animals left in the world could still be saved if deforested forests would only be reforested and the practice of slash and burn of forests would be totally abandoned.

Social effects of deforestation

Deforestation is hardly hitting the living conditions of indigenous people who consider forests as their primary habitats. Imagine how they are rendered homeless when forests are depleted. These natives would be forced to live elsewhere, and are usually left to becoming mendicants in rural and urban areas.

Fact vs Fiction - A Salt Water Pool Review

If you have been considering purchasing a new salt water pool or if you want to convert your existing chlorine system with a salt system, then you should consider a few common misconceptions. With the sudden popularity of these pools there are a lot of myths that have been propagated by owners and sellers alike.

No more worrying about pH levels.

Keeping salt pools clear of germs and algae requires a balance of germ killing chemicals. Chlorine is the primary disinfectant used in a pool. Many homeowners though find that they are needing to add more chlorine to effectively kill germs. This can be attributed to high pH levels. A balanced pH and alkaline level is essential to maintaining optimum chlorination. Not only that but pH levels will also affect the comfort of swimmers. Levels about 7.8 could lead to eye and skin irritation. Most pool owners convert to salt water pools because they are told they are maintenance free. This is not true. Balanced water is essential and this requires frequent testing.

You can taste both the salt and the chlorine.

A properly maintained salt water pool has a salinity level around 10 per cent of water from the ocean. Most salt water pool owners can attest to the fact that the water in a salt water pool is very similar to that of water that has been softened. Soft water has a better feel and is less harsh on skin and clothing. Salt water pools with the proper level of salt will not have a noticeable difference in taste.

Salt water pools don't require maintenance.

New owners of salt water pools quickly discover that these systems do require maintenance. While you do not have to continually add chlorine as with standard pools you do need to maintain the chlorine generation cells. Most salt water pools use titanium plates that are electronically charged to turn salt water into chlorine. Calcium builds up in the 'cells' and must be cleaned. Failure to do so will result in reduced chlorine generation and your pool will no longer be able to fight off germs and algae. Maintaining proper salt levels will also shorten the life of the chlorine generation cells. So there are times when either water or additional salt will need to be added to the pool.

Salt water pools are cheaper then regular pools.

There is a lot of confusion on this point. So let's clear things up. The cost savings on one of these pools is based primarily on how long you own the pool and how well it is maintained. This is because salt pools are initially more expensive to install. Over a short period of time a standard chlorine system is cheaper. However continued operation costs over the next couple of years will begin to surpass that of a salt water pool. Chlorinated pools are constantly losing chlorine. Sunlight, splash outs and inclement weather are usually reducing the amount of chlorine requiring the use of chlorine pucks and pool shock systems. These can be expensive and dangerous to handle. There are other costs associated with salt water pools. Replacing pave stones, pump parts and chlorine generators can be expensive. In the end salt water pools aren't very cheap at all.
